If Rs.x was invested at 12% per annum simple interest and a sum of money Rs.y is invested at 10% per annum simple interest. If the sum of the interest on both the sum after 4 years is Rs.480. If the ratio between x and y is 5 : 6, the later sum of money is

  1. Rs.500

  2. Rs.550

  3. Rs.600

  4. Rs.750

C Correct answer
Explanation

Simple interest = Principal × Rate × Time. For Rs.x at 12% for 4 years: SI₁ = x × 0.12 × 4 = 0.48x. For Rs.y at 10% for 4 years: SI₂ = y × 0.10 × 4 = 0.40y. Total interest: 0.48x + 0.40y = 480. Given x:y = 5:6, let x = 5k, y = 6k. Then 0.48(5k) + 0.40(6k) = 480, so 2.4k + 2.4k = 480, giving 4.8k = 480 and k = 100. Therefore y = 6k = Rs.600. Option C is correct.
